Product Matters: Picking the Right Screw Type
Stainless steel screws are a popular selection for Longmont decks since they stand up magnificently against dampness and temperature shifts. They're a little bit pricier, however, for home owners planning to appreciate their deck for years, the financial investment pays off. Covered deck screws, often identified as exterior-grade, supply a more budget-friendly option while still giving strong protection against the elements.
If your deck is developed from cedar or one more normally moisture-rich timber, you'll desire screws specifically rated for that material. Some finishings react badly with the natural tannins in cedar, causing dark staining around each screw head. No one desires their brand-new deck looking identified by July.
Length and Gauge: Getting the Specifications Right
Selecting the proper screw length depends upon your decking thickness. As a basic policy, screws ought to penetrate the joist below by at the very least an inch for a safe and secure hold. Thicker composite boards, which have grown preferred among Longmont homeowners for their reduced maintenance, often call for longer screws than standard wood outdoor decking.
Evaluate issues as well. A heavier gauge screw resists shearing forces much better, which is especially handy if your deck sees heavy summer season use, believe huge events, grills, jacuzzis, or furnishings that gets moved often.

It's additionally worth asking about head designs. Trim-head screws sit virtually flush and work great for ended up, polished appearances, while star-drive heads reduce removing throughout setup, a small detail that conserves a lot of stress on a hot mid-day.

Upkeep Tips for the Relax of Summer season
When your deck is built or repaired, a little upkeep goes a long way. Check screw heads regularly throughout the summer season, particularly after a significant storm. Warm and moisture cycles can trigger mild motion, and capturing a loosened screw early protects against bigger migraines later on. A fast walk-through every few weeks, focusing on high-traffic locations like stairs and railings, assists you remain ahead of any kind of issues.
Cleaning your deck on a regular basis also helps safeguard your fasteners. Dirt and debris trap wetness against the wood, which accelerates rust even on high quality screws. An easy rinse with a hose, followed by a soft brush for persistent areas, keeps everything looking fresh and functioning properly.
